Vivienne Westwood’s Granddaughter Cora Corre Has Been Signed to Next Model Management

Jul 24, 2014  |   Contributor: Marissa Stempien

Vivienne Westwood’s granddaughter Cora Corre has just been signed to Next Model Management. The 16-year-old—whose grandmother is one of fashion’s most eccentric designers and whose mother, Serena Rees, co-founded Agent Provocateur—has been dabbling in fashion for years, but it looks like her career is about to take off. ... Nadè ge Vanhee-Cybulski Replaces Christophe Lemaire as Creative Director for Hermè s

Jul 24, 2014  |   Contributor: Marissa Stempien

Monday Hermès announced that their artistic director of womenswear, Christophe Lemaire, would be stepping down from his post in October to focus on his own label. While replacing Marc Jacobs at Louis Vuitton took some time, and Mulberry is still without a creative director, we were surprised to hear that just three days later, the first rumors were true.... John Varvatos Snags Beatle Ringo Starr for New Fall 14 #PeaceRocks Campaign

Jul 10, 2014  |   Contributor: Marissa Stempien

John Varvatos is known for collaborating with musicians for each of his collections—last season saw Kiss posing on the runway, while previous muses have included Jimmy Page, ZZ Top and the Dave Matthews Band. But the Fall 2015 campaign is about to feature rock-n-roll royalty with an appearance by Ringo Starr. ... Read More
